首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Docker Swarm --advertise-addr更改

Docker Swarm是Docker官方提供的一个容器编排和管理工具,用于在多个Docker主机上创建和管理容器集群。它允许用户通过简单的命令和配置文件来定义和管理容器的部署、伸缩和服务发现。

--advertise-addr是Docker Swarm中的一个参数,用于指定Swarm节点的广告地址。广告地址是Swarm集群中节点之间通信的地址,用于节点之间的发现和通信。通过指定--advertise-addr参数,可以确保Swarm节点使用正确的地址进行通信。

在Docker Swarm中,可以使用以下命令来更改--advertise-addr参数:

代码语言:txt
复制
docker swarm init --advertise-addr <address>

上述命令将初始化一个Swarm集群,并指定节点的广告地址为<address>

--advertise-addr参数的优势在于:

  1. 灵活性:可以根据实际需求灵活地指定节点的广告地址,以适应不同的网络环境和配置要求。
  2. 可扩展性:通过更改广告地址,可以轻松地扩展Swarm集群,添加或替换节点。
  3. 可靠性:使用正确的广告地址可以确保Swarm节点之间的通信正常,提高集群的可靠性和稳定性。

Docker Swarm的应用场景包括但不限于:

  1. 微服务架构:通过Docker Swarm可以轻松地部署和管理多个微服务,实现服务的快速伸缩和高可用性。
  2. 容器化应用部署:使用Docker Swarm可以将应用程序容器化,并在Swarm集群中进行部署和管理,简化应用的部署和维护过程。
  3. 负载均衡和服务发现:Docker Swarm提供了负载均衡和服务发现的功能,可以自动将请求路由到可用的容器实例,并实现服务的自动发现和注册。

腾讯云提供了一系列与Docker Swarm相关的产品和服务,包括:

  1. 容器服务 TKE:腾讯云的容器服务,支持Docker Swarm等多种容器编排工具,提供高可用、弹性伸缩的容器集群管理能力。
  2. 云服务器 CVM:腾讯云的云服务器产品,可用于部署和管理Docker Swarm节点。
  3. 负载均衡 CLB:腾讯云的负载均衡产品,可用于在Docker Swarm集群中实现负载均衡和服务发现。

以上是关于Docker Swarm --advertise-addr更改的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券